Understanding what typically causes water damage in Spencertown can help you catch a problem early — before it turns into a full emergency call.
Supply lines behind washing machines, dishwashers, and refrigerators wear out over time. When they fail, water can spread through a Spencertown property for hours before anyone notices, soaking into flooring and cabinetry.
Storm damage often shows up first as a small ceiling stain in Spencertown properties, but by the time it's visible, water has usually already reached the insulation and framing underneath.
A failed sump pump during a heavy rain event is one of the fastest ways a Spencertown basement goes from dry to flooded — often within a single storm, with little warning.
A slowly failing water heater in a Spencertown home can leak for weeks before it's discovered, often causing more structural damage than a sudden pipe burst would.
Poor drainage patterns are a frequent contributor to recurring water issues in Spencertown basements, especially in older neighborhoods with mature landscaping and settled soil.
Water used to extinguish a fire, or an accidental sprinkler discharge, can leave a Spencertown property with significant secondary water damage that needs immediate attention right after the fire crew leaves.

Plenty of Spencertown homeowners try to handle a small water event themselves before calling us. Here's what usually gets missed.
The visible water on your Spencertown floor is often only part of the problem. Water wicks upward into drywall, travels along subfloor seams, and pools inside wall cavities where a rented fan will never reach it. Without professional-grade dehumidification and moisture monitoring, that hidden dampness can sit for weeks, quietly feeding mold growth long after the surface looks and feels dry to the touch.
There's also the insurance side to consider. Without professional documentation — moisture readings, photos, a written scope of work — it can be much harder to support a claim if secondary damage shows up later. Our Spencertown technicians build that documentation as part of every job, protecting you if issues surface down the road.
If the water was minor, contained, and cleaned up within an hour or two, DIY handling is often fine. Once it's soaked into materials or sat for any real length of time, though, a professional assessment is the safer move for your Spencertown property.
The minutes before our Spencertown crew arrives matter. Here's what our dispatchers typically recommend, situation permitting.
Turning off the source, if it's safe to do so, is often the single most effective thing you can do before help arrives.
Never touch electrical switches, outlets, or appliances that are wet or near standing water — the risk of shock is real.
Lifting rugs, moving boxes, and relocating valuables can reduce secondary damage while you wait for our team.
A quick photo record of standing water and affected belongings makes the insurance process smoother down the line.
If weather allows, opening windows or doors can help slow humidity buildup until our Spencertown team arrives with drying equipment.
Delaying the call is the most common mistake we see. Standing water only gets more expensive to fix the longer it sits.
